After getting her motorcycle license during the pandemic, mayo fell for a Royal Enfield Classic 350 in Halcyon Green on Instagram. She has gradually customized it with Italian long mirrors and a custom rear rack, racked up about 23,000km, and now enjoys camping tours on it.
